Gracias, lo voy a probar en un rato, me parece muy útil.Eldarc escribió: ↑18 Dic 2020, 19:06 Respondiendo a la última pregunta, lo de los "botones" como el de Mayor Intensidad, son elementos que he creado en el Journal y que he arrastrado hasta el "editor de texto" de la ficha. Al guardar la edición de texto y pinchar en él, se abre ese elemento del Journal.
Mola saber que le ha gustado, básicamente me patee las plantillas html y cambié cosas siguiendo la documentación de Foundryvtt, aparte creé dos ficheros con las palabras traducidas, uno para el inglés con los términos originales y otro en español.Eldarc escribió: ↑18 Dic 2020, 19:06 Por cierto, te está muy agradecido porque dice que le quitaste mucho trabajo. No sé exactamente qué hiciste ni cómo lo hiciste, pero está encantado. Concretamente me dijo: "Also if you see the person who made the edits please thank him or her for me. It allowed me to finish my work a lot faster.". No sé si se refería a mí o a ti, pero juraría que habla de tu Pull Request, porque yo le pasé mis traducciones en un excel.
Cuando lo he querido usar para mi campaña me he dado cuenta de que los compendios es mejor traducirlos usando babele, por lo que he tenido que cambian una función javascript que localiza las habilidades, porque se estaba pegando con babele.
Las habilidades están en un compendio mythras/packs/standardskill.db me fijé que dentro cada una tiene una clave numérica "sort". La manera elegante de arreglarlo, sería viendo dónde está el método javascript que usa para ordenar la matriz de habilidades y modificarlo para que en lugar de usar el valor numérico "sort" usara el nombre una vez traducido, se que usa la librería array-sort, pero no he encontrado donde lo organiza y yo de javascript, lo cierto es que no controlo, apenas lo leo a trancas y barrancas.Eldarc escribió: ↑18 Dic 2020, 19:06
- ¿Cómo has hecho para ordenar alfabéticamente las Habilidades Básicas? Las mías están ordenadas alfabéticamente pero utilizando los nombres en inglés (aunque se muestran en castellano). Así que yo veo Manejo de Botes (Boating) como la segunda habilidad de la lista.
Dado que tenía prisa por preparar partida, hice un script en python que modifica el compendio original, en inglés, para darle a "sort" unos valores acordes a la ordenación en español, lo tengo en ...systems/translate_mythras.py
Dado que esto lo hice antes de empezar a usar babele, voy a tener que modificarlo para que funcione mirando el compendio traducido siguiendo el formato de babele, o eso, o encontrar donde ordena las cosas usando javascript.
Estoy jugando a Fantasía clásica y así es como los jugadores marcan sus habilidades cláseas, las que usan para subir de nivel.
Tenemos unos cuantos iconos más que marcan otras cosas, como por ejemplo habilidades aumentadas po un familiar, etc.
Ahora que he visto como lo hace el autor en las partes de javascript, creo que igual puedo arreglar eso.Eldarc escribió: ↑18 Dic 2020, 19:06 "Feeling fresh" y compañía están en:
\Data\systems\mythras\module\actor\actor.js (1 trobats)
Line 274: fresh: 'Feeling fresh!',
Las dificultades y mensajes como Resultado, etc... que salen en el chat cuando haces una tirada de habilidad están en:
Data\systems\mythras\module\actor\sheet\base.js (1 trobats)
Line 348: 'Formidable: '
Line 360: '<h3><strong>Resultado: ' + rolled.result + '</strong></h3>'
Line 354: let label = dataset.label ? `Tirada de ${dataLabel[0]}` : '
Calculo que estas navidades tendré tiempo para modificar todo y mandarle un Pull Request, intentaré incorporar tus correcciones.Eldarc escribió: ↑18 Dic 2020, 19:06 Por cierto, sí encontré más gazapos, pero ya le envié las correcciones por Discord. Lo que pasa que no sé cuánto tardará en actualizarlo, ni qué pasará si ahora tú editas el archivo... Había más cosas como "Nueva equipo", y tonterías de estas. Te comparto el archivo de las traducciónes que bajé, corregí y que le mandé:
https://1drv.ms/u/s!Atmk7VfHsnfCj9YxKPp ... Q?e=j4RcUI
Aparte tengo que cambiar el compendio que comparta, yo lo tengo con cosas sacadas del manual de Mythras y Fantasía clásica y hay que cambiarlo a lo que hay en Mythras imperativo.